The county board of education, upon the recommendation of the county superintendent of education, shall appoint a sufficient number of enumerators to take the census of the county during the month of July or at such other time as the State Superintendent of Education shall cause the whole or any part of any school census in a county to be retaken. The county board of education, upon the recommendation of the county superintendent of education, shall fix the compensation of the enumerators taking any school census and shall order them paid out of the treasury of the county.
